Sustainable livestock futures
ILRI’s Sustainable Livestock Futures Programme analyses the complex interactions between livestock systems, poverty, and the environment. Its strong multi-disciplinary team conducts foresight studies on emerging livestock development challenges with uncertain future impacts and signals their importance for other ILRI Programmes and policy makers. The rapidly growing demand for livestock products in developing countries and the importance of livestock in household asset portfolios provides great potential for using livestock to reduce poverty. The Programme enhances the contribution of ILRI’s research to poverty reduction by identifying, in collaboration with other ILRI Projects, specific pathways for sustainable poverty reduction and entry points where livestock research can play a role.
